namespace corelinux
{
CORELINUX_VECTOR( IdentifierPtr , EventIdentifiers );
DECLARE_CLASS( Mediator );
DECLARE_CLASS( Colleague );
/**
Colleague knows its Mediator object, communicates with its mediator
whenever it would have otherwise communicated with another Colleague.
*/
class Colleague
{
public:
//
// Constructors and destructor
//
/**
Default constructor requires a Mediator
@param Mediator pointer
@exception NullPointerException if MediatorPtr
is NULLPTR
*/
Colleague( MediatorPtr )
throw ( NullPointerException );
/**
Copy constructor copies the mediator
reference
@param Colleague const referencee
*/
Colleague( ColleagueCref );
/// Virtual destructor
virtual ~Colleague( void );
//
// Operator overloads
//
/// Assignment operator
ColleagueRef operator=( ColleagueCref );
/// Equality operator
bool operator==( ColleagueCref ) const;
//
// Accessors
//
/**
Implementation defined to return the identifiers
of the events that this Colleague generates
@param EventIdentifiers vector reference
*/
virtual void getEventsGenerated( EventIdentifiersRef ) = 0;
/**
Implementation defined to return the identifiers
of the events that this Colleague is interested in
@param EventIdentifiers vector reference
*/
virtual void getInterestedEvents( EventIdentifiersRef ) = 0;
//
// Mutators
//
/**
Called by the mediator when another Colleague has
generated an event that this colleague instance
is interested in.
@param Event pointer to event
*/
virtual void action( Event<Identifier> * ) = 0;
protected:
//
// Constructor
//
/// Default constructor not allowed
Colleague( void ) throw ( Assertion );
//
// Service method
//
/**
Called by the Colleague implementation to have
the Mediator::action called with the event type
@param Event pointer to event
@exception NullPointerException if EventPtr is NULLPTR
*/
virtual void invokeMediator( Event<Identifier> * ) throw ( NullPointerException );
private:
/// The Mediator that this Colleague knows
MediatorPtr theMediator;
};
}
